Etheridge, Military Veterans in Congress Urge President to Provide Troops Benefits

WASHINGTON - U.S. Rep. Bob Etheridge (D-Lillington) and several of his fellow military veterans in Congress this week urged President Bush to provide fair pay, good health benefits and a secure retirement for those who serve in the military. Etheridge and his colleagues wrote to the President encouraging him to support concurrent receipt for disabled veterans, additional funding for VA hospitals and access to military health care for members of the National Guard and Reserves.

"Our men and women in uniform are serving with honor around the globe to protect our nation's freedom. They deserve to know not only that their country appreciates their service and their sacrifice, but that they and their families will be taken care of now and in the future," Etheridge said. "I can support the President's request for funds to help the military get the job done in Iraq, but I want to make sure that our troops and veterans don't pay the price."

In the letter, Etheridge calls on the President to support concurrent receipt. Currently, disabled veterans who are also military retirees have their disability payments docked by the amount of their retirement. Etheridge supports legislation that would correct this flaw and is one of 202 signers of a discharge petition that, with 16 more signatures, would force a vote on this important legislation.

Etheridge and his colleagues also ask the President to support increasing funding for the Veterans' Administration by $1.8 billion and withdraw his proposals to increase premiums and prescription drug copayments for veterans seeking to access health care. Nearly 200,000 veterans have been waiting six months or more for an appointment at VA hospitals. Additional funding would help give more veterans access to affordable health care.
